KAFKA CLI - 101

Kafka Producer-Consumer Flow Steps:

  1. Start Zookeeper
    • The default port of zookeeper is 2181
.\bin\windows\zookeeper-server-start.bat .\config\zookeeper.properties
  1. Start Kafka Server
    • The default port of kafka server/broker is 9092
.\bin\windows\kafka-server-start.bat .\config\server.properties
  1. Create a Topic
    • The default port of kafka server/broker is 9092
.\bin\windows\kafka-topics.bat --bootstrap-server localhost:9092 --create --topic my-1st-topic --partitions 3 --replication-factor 1
.\bin\windows\kafka-topics.bat --bootstrap-server localhost:9092 --create --topic my-2nd-topic --partitions 3 --replication-factor 1
.\bin\windows\kafka-topics.bat --bootstrap-server localhost:9092 --list
.\bin\windows\kafka-topics.bat --bootstrap-server localhost:9092 --describe --topic <topicName>

  1. To start the producer using CLI
.\bin\windows\kafka-console-producer.bat --broker-list localhost:9092 --topic my-1st-topic
Get-Content E:\Coding\the-kafka-project\src\main\resources\csv\customers-10000.csv | .\bin\windows\kafka-console-producer.bat --broker-list localhost:9092 --topic my-1st-topic
  1. To start the consumer using CLI
.\bin\windows\kafka-console-consumer.bat --bootstrap-server localhost:9092 --topic my-1st-topic --from-beginning

KAFKA using Docker

docker compose -f .\docker\docker-compose.yml up -d
  • For using the bash inside the kafka container
docker exec -it <kafka_container_name> bash
  • navigate to the bin dir inside the kafka container --> /opt/kafka_version/bin/

  • To create a kafka topic

kafka-topics.sh --zookeeper zookeeper:2181 --create --topic my-1st-topic --partitions 3 --replication-factor 1
  • To start a kafka producer for a specific topic
kafka-console-producer.sh --bootstrap-server localhost:9092 --topic my-1st-topic
  • To start a kafka consumer for a specific topic
kafka-console-consumer.sh --bootstrap-server localhost:9092 --topic my-1st-topic --from-beginning
